Safety is the paramount concern for children's products. You must ensure the supplier complies with EN71 (European Standard), ASTM F963 (US Standard), or ISO 8124. Specifically, verify that the materials are BPA-free and non-toxic, and the product has passed stability tests to prevent tipping. For the US market, a Children's Product Certificate (CPC) is mandatory.
For toddlers (10-24 months), prioritize 360-degree rotating seats, 5-point safety harnesses, and parental push handles with steering control. For older children (2-5 years), look for foldable footrests, adjustable seats, and the ability to detach the push rod to convert the unit into a classic independent tricycle.
The frame should ideally be made of high-carbon steel or aluminum alloy for a balance of strength and weight. For wheels, EVA foam wheels are cost-effective and puncture-proof, while rubber air-filled tires provide superior shock absorption for outdoor terrains. Ensure the welding points are smooth and the paint is lead-free powder coating to prevent chipping.
Foldable designs significantly reduce shipping volumes (CBM), which lowers your landed cost per unit. Modular '4-in-1' or '7-in-1' designs offer a longer product lifecycle, allowing parents to use the same product as the child grows, which increases the marketability and retail value of your inventory.
Always request a pre-shipment inspection (PSI) by a third-party agency like SGS or Intertek. Focus on mechanical physical tests (small parts cylinder test to prevent choking) and chemical testing for phthalates. Negotiate based on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) rather than just the unit price. Ask for spare parts (1-2% extra wheels or pedals) to be included in the bulk price to handle future warranty claims. If you are a long-term buyer, negotiate for OEM/ODM customization such as adding your brand logo on the fabric canopy or frame at no extra cost for high-volume orders.
Baby tricycles are often 'volumetric' cargo. Ensure the supplier uses 5-layer corrugated export cartons with internal foam protection to prevent scratches during transit. Request SKD (Semi-Knocked Down) or CKD (Completely Knocked Down) packaging to maximize container utilization rates, which can reduce freight costs by up to 20%.

Be aware of anti-dumping duties that some regions may impose on bicycles/tricycles from specific countries, and ensure all HS Codes (typically 950300) are correctly declared on the Bill of Lading.
